Ekblad Suspended 20 Games for Performance Enhancing Substance Violation

The NHL has suspended Florida Panthers defenseman Aaron Ekblad for 20 games, without pay, for violating the NHL/NHLPA Performance Enhancing Substances Program. Ekblad will also attend the NHL/NHLPA Program for Substance Abuse and Behavioral Health under mandatory referral for evaluation and possible treatment. Erik Johnson Traded to the Colorado Avalanche

The Colorado Avalanche have reacquired defenseman Erik Johnson from the Philadelphia Flyers for Givani Smith. The trade is one-for-one. Johnson was drafted by the St. Louis Blues first overall in the 2006 NHL Entry Draft before he was traded to the Colorado Avalanche in 2011. Cody Glass traded to the New Jersey Devils

The New Jersey Devils have acquired Cody Glass and Jonathan Gruden from the Pittsburgh Penguins in exchange for a 2027 third-round pick, Chase Stillman, and Max Graham.
